NU Basketball to Play In Las Vegas Invitational with UCLA, Missouri, Nevada

As we reported yesterday, Northwestern will play in the 2013 Las Vegas Invitational on Nov. 29 and 30 for its annual preseason tournament. Now, Jeff Goodman of CBS Sports also has tweeted that NU will be playing in Las Vegas, along with UCLA, Missouri and Nevada.

The Las Vegas Invitational will clearly be a step up for the NU program, which has been to the South Padre Invitational and the Charleston Classic the last two years. It will be a step up in competition and a step up in exposure — last year’s Las Vegas Invitational was broadcast on ESPN 2, while the South Padre Invitational was broadcast on the little-watched CBS Sports Network. NU will be playing at least two of those three teams — semifinal and championship/consolation game — so it will get an elite opponent no matter what.

This year's non-conferenece slate is shaping up to be a tough one for the Wildcats, who are no doubt trying to create excitement in the program's first year under Chris Collins. In addition to Vegas, NU has games at Stanford and Butler. The Wildcats will also play an ACC/Big Ten Challenge game. NU may also bring in another high-profile opponent to try to drum up early-season fan support, since that has typically been the goal of the athletic department — it would make even more sense this year.
